Live a debt free life

Free money. It sounds too good to be true. But if you are careful there is loads of it out there. You have to pay it back of course. But for six or even nine months you can buy stuff on credit and pay no interest on it. And if you play your cards right, you can move the debt at the end of that time and pay no interest for even longer.

There are more than 20 credit cards out there offering zero percent interest on purchases for six months or more. At the time of writing, PC World Marbles Card offers nine months at 0%! So take out a card and do your shopping. When the 0% deal runs out, find a new card – this time one that offers 0% on balance transfers. Again, there are around 20 of them. Move your balance and enjoy more interest free debt. You can carry on like this as long as you can find and get a new card. But remember you will have to pay the debt off at some point.

Make sure you only use the card for the 0% rate. Don’t take out cash – there will be charges and interest – and don’t buy anything on the card once the free interest comes to an end. If you transfer a balance to a new card do not use that card to buy anything or you may end up paying interest.

Above all, take care. Debt is debt. But with a bit of thought it can at least be interest free.
